Understanding Lithium Testing and Its Clinical Importance
The Lithium Test represents a critical component in the management of bipolar disorder and other psychiatric conditions where lithium carbonate serves as a primary treatment modality. This therapeutic drug monitoring test provides essential data that enables healthcare providers to maintain lithium concentrations within the narrow therapeutic window necessary for effective treatment while minimizing the risk of toxicity. Lithium’s unique pharmacological properties require careful monitoring due to its narrow therapeutic index, where small changes in blood levels can significantly impact both efficacy and safety.
What the Lithium Test Measures
The Lithium Test precisely quantifies the concentration of lithium ions in the bloodstream using advanced colorimetric methodology. This sophisticated analytical technique provides accurate measurements of serum lithium levels, which are crucial for:
- Determining if lithium concentrations fall within the therapeutic range (typically 0.6-1.2 mmol/L)
- Identifying subtherapeutic levels that may reduce treatment effectiveness
- Detecting potentially toxic levels that could cause serious adverse effects
- Monitoring long-term stability of lithium concentrations

Clinical Indications and Symptoms Requiring Monitoring
Regular lithium monitoring becomes particularly crucial when patients exhibit symptoms that may indicate improper lithium levels. These include fine hand tremors, increased thirst and urination, weight gain, gastrointestinal discomfort, or cognitive changes. Additionally, patients with comorbid medical conditions affecting kidney function, thyroid status, or electrolyte balance require more frequent monitoring to ensure safe lithium administration.

Understanding Your Lithium Test Results
Interpreting lithium test results requires careful consideration of clinical context and individual patient factors. Generally, results fall into three categories:
- Therapeutic Range (0.6-1.2 mmol/L): Indicates optimal lithium levels for treatment effectiveness with minimal toxicity risk
- Subtherapeutic (<0.6 mmol/L): May suggest inadequate dosing, poor absorption, or increased elimination
- Potentially Toxic (>1.2 mmol/L): Requires immediate medical attention and possible dosage adjustment
It’s essential to discuss results with your healthcare provider, as individual target ranges may vary based on clinical condition, treatment phase, and patient-specific factors. Regular monitoring typically occurs every 3-6 months during stable maintenance therapy and more frequently during dosage changes or clinical instability.
